Sound Artists Edward Bennet and Boris Alenou will exhibit their instruments
and scores at Davis MakerSpace on Friday August 9.  Edward Bennet, a
graduate of blank, will exhibit exhibit haunting and jarring compostitions
that been evolving on Twitter, a collection scores drawn from the pages of
Thomas Pynchon’s seminal work Gravity’s Rainbow.  Boris Alenou, a PhD
student doing research in blank at U.C. Davis, and a former member of
Paris’ ecological Makerspace, will present playful and interactive
electronic sound sculptures composed of recycled materials.
